Handover — Studio 4, Lenmark House

For whoever's settling in the new starters this week: the training video studio is booked through the Pellwick calendar, not the normal room tool. Lights stay on the preset marked "Talking Head"; don't re-rig them. Return lapel mics to the charging drawer, and log any dead batteries on the whiteboard. The studio stays locked outside bookings because of the camera kit. New starters can let themselves in for scheduled sessions using the door code below.

badge for fafop-fajof: bdg-Z-47

## Who to ping about GiftNote

Welcome aboard! GiftNote is our donation-receipt mailer for the Larchfield Fund. Template tweaks go to the comms folks; delivery failures and bounce weirdness go to the platform crew. Don't push template changes on Fridays — receipts batch over the weekend. For anything GiftNote-related, start with the address below.

billing contact of kaweg-tajeg = drudor.lamion.oliath@torvalabs.test

## Runbook: Gaugepile Sidecar — Release Checklist

Heads up: the sidecar ships with every app pod, so a bad config fans out fast. Before cutting a release, confirm the flush interval hasn't drifted from what the Tallyhouse aggregator expects, or you'll see sawtooth gaps in dashboards. Rollbacks are cheap — just repin the image tag. Canary one node pool first, watch for ten minutes, then proceed. The values to verify against are these.

config for bagep-yafof:
quenath:
  pin: 8584
  metrics_host: metrics.quenath.tolvaqsys.internal
  tenant: pelath
  seal: seal_ed102645

### Rotating secrets with Vaultspin

Welcome to on-call! Our in-house rotation tool, Vaultspin, cycles credentials for most Copperhatch services every 30 days. Usually it's hands-off, but if a rotation job wedges, you'll see a `ROTATE_STALLED` page — just rerun `vaultspin retry` with the affected service name and it sorts itself out. One quirk: Vaultspin itself authenticates to the internal Keysmith broker with a static bootstrap credential. That bootstrap key goes on the line below.

app token of kajop-tahag = qvz23-qaEp6MzrfP2AwhVbZwsZeUq